Understanding Residential Boarding Up: A Comprehensive Guide
As severe weather occasions and socio-political discontent become more frequent, numerous homeowners are thinking about boarding up their residential or commercial properties to safeguard versus prospective damage. Residential boarding up includes covering windows, doors, and other openings with boards to prevent vandalism, theft, or storm damage. This post explores the various aspects of residential boarding up, including its significance, methods, products, and important factors to consider.
Why is Residential Boarding Up Necessary?
Residential boarding up serves numerous purposes, mostly concentrated on safety and protection. The following are crucial reasons property owners go with this precautionary measure:
Protection from Extreme Weather: Hurricanes, storms, and heavy snowfall can cause substantial damage to vulnerable homes. Boarding up assists avoid broken windows and water intrusion.
Deterring Crime and Vandalism: In locations with high crime rates or throughout civil unrest, boarding up makes a home less appealing to possible vandals or thieves.
Insurance coverage Requirements: Some insurer might require a home to be boarded up in particular conditions to prevent claim rejections.

Methods of Residential Boarding Up
Homeowners can select from different approaches to board up their homes. The option mostly depends upon budget plan, skill level, and the type of protection needed.
Methods Include:
Plywood Boarding: The most common method involves utilizing sheets of plywood, normally 5/8-inch thick, that can be cut to fit doors and windows.
Typhoon Shutters: These are long-term components that can be set up over doors and windows. They provide more robust protection than plywood and can be deployed quickly.
Lexan or Polycarbonate Panels: Clear, long lasting panels that permit light to enter however avoid things from breaking through. These are frequently a more aesthetically pleasing alternative to plywood.
Metal Screens: These screens can offer a long-lasting service for securing windows, especially in locations vulnerable to robbery.
Expandable Barriers: Some homeowners choose expandable barriers that can be gotten used to fit different openings. These can be more costly but use greater benefit.

Materials Used for Boarding Up
When thinking about residential boarding up, the type of products utilized can considerably influence efficiency and toughness. Here are some commonly utilized products:
Common Materials:
Plywood: Widely readily available and economical; usually dealt with for weather resistance.
Lexan/Polycarbonate: Offers protection with presence; can stand up to significant impact.
Metal Panels: Robust and long lasting; often used in commercial structures however can be adjusted for residential usage.
Screws/Bolts: Essential for protecting the boards to the property frame. It's important to use resistant products to prevent rust.
Cyclone Clips: For protecting plywood boards to windows and doors more effectively, particularly in typhoon zones.

Secret Considerations for Residential Boarding Up
Before proceeding with residential boarding up, several factors ought to be taken into account. The following things can guide house owners:
Local Regulations: Verify local building regulations and any guidelines that apply to boarding up houses. Some areas might have constraints related to external adjustments.
Window Types: Different windows (sash, sliding, and so on) might need particular boarding techniques. Take precise measurements.
Setup Timing: It is perfect to board up before any predicted storm or civil unrest to make sure that your property is properly secured from the start.
Securing Insurance: Consult with your insurance coverage supplier to understand any requirements for boarding up and ensure that the property is covered.
Do it yourself vs. Professional Help: Assess your abilities or think about employing professionals for installation, as incorrect boarding may result in inadequate protection.
